what the different between past progressive and past simple

give an example of each

Respuesta :

fwnattyy
fwnattyy fwnattyy
  • 29-10-2019
the simple past talks about something that happened before .The past progressive talks about something that was happening before, but for a period of time. It uses was or were + verb-ing like was eating or were playing. It gives a background for something that was happening while a different event happened.

Past progressive Example: He was painting the door when a bird struck the window.

Simple past example: I didn't see a play yesterday.
